Ukraine’s Ministry for Development of Communities and Territories has announced the launch of a concession tender for the Chornomorsk port, with the concession term set at 40 years. The tender covers the “First” and “Container” terminals of the port, also referred to as the Universal and Grain marine terminals. According to the ministry’s press service,

the concession tender will be conducted in the format of a competitive dialogue. This approach allows shortlisted bidders to engage in discussions with the contracting authority to refine technical, financial and legal aspects of their proposals before submitting final bids. The concession asset includes existing movable and immovable property recorded on the balance sheet of the state enterprise Chornomorsk Sea Commercial Port within the Universal and Grain terminals. It also covers movable and immovable assets, including berths Nos. 1–6, belonging to the state enterprise Ukrainian Sea Ports Authority within the same terminals. In addition, the concession will include any assets created or constructed by the concessionaire during the term of the concession agreement. This encompasses newly built immovable property as well as movable assets acquired by the concessionaire in accordance with the terms of the contract.
